A group of people working to keep former inmates out of prison after their reentry to society are meeting in Richmond this week.

The Virginia Out4Life reentry conference is being held by Prison Fellowship, a national organization based in Leesburg, Virginia.
It's hosting a series of conferences around the United States.
The organization hopes to bring everyone together across the Commonwealth, from government to non-profits and faith based groups, to help inmates with a smooth return to society.
"The equation is getting people off the street into prison, is one part of public safety. Getting those individuals ready to return back home so they're law abiding citizens and actually contributors to society is the back end of public safety, and that's what we're here to work on today with a community-based approach that doesn't cost the state money," says Prison Fellowship President and CEO Mark Earley.
